Eikodden
Eikodden is a headland in Skien, Telemark, Innlandet and has an elevation of 22 metres. Eikodden is situated nearby to the locality Helgen, as well as near Verstad.Places of Interest

Helgen Church
Church
Photo: Bohuslen, CC BY-SA 3.0 no.
Helgen Church is a parish church of the Church of Norway in Nome Municipality in Telemark county, Norway. It is located in the village of Helgja. It is one of the churches for the Holla og Helgen parish which is part of the Øvre Telemark prosti in the Diocese of Agder og Telemark. Helgen Church is situated 3½ km west of Eikodden.
